Why Quality Training Determines Long-Term Success in Clinical Research Careers
Clinical research has become one of the most structured and opportunity-driven fields within the healthcare and pharmaceutical industries. As global demand for safer medicines, advanced therapies, and innovative medical devices increases, the need for skilled professionals who can manage research processes responsibly continues to grow. This shift has opened doors for students and fresh graduates who are looking for stable, meaningful, and future-oriented careers.
Unlike many traditional roles, clinical research offers a
combination of scientific involvement, ethical responsibility, and professional
growth. Professionals working in this field contribute to every stage of drug
development, ensuring that new treatments meet safety and efficacy standards
before reaching patients. This sense of responsibility and impact makes
clinical research a highly respected career path for the next generation.
Why the Industry Needs Well-Trained Clinical Research
Professionals
The clinical research process is complex and highly
regulated. It involves strict adherence to protocols, accurate documentation,
patient safety monitoring, and compliance with global regulatory guidelines.
Any error, delay, or inconsistency can affect the outcome of a clinical trial.
This is why companies today prioritize candidates who are trained to handle
real-world research responsibilities.

How Specialized Training Improves Career Opportunities
One of the biggest advantages of enrolling in professional
programs is the clarity they provide about career pathways. With focused clinical
trial training in Pune, students gain insight into various roles such
as Clinical Research Coordinator (CRC), Clinical Research Associate (CRA), Drug
Safety Associate, Medical Writer, and Data Management Executive.
This exposure helps learners identify their strengths and
interests early, allowing them to plan their career progression more
effectively. It also improves their confidence during interviews, as they can
demonstrate practical knowledge and real-world understanding rather than just
academic learning.

The Future of Clinical Research Careers
The future of clinical research looks extremely promising,
especially in India. With increasing global collaborations, digital
transformation of trials, and expansion of research facilities, job
opportunities are expected to rise significantly. Professionals entering the
field today will be part of an industry that continues to evolve with new
technologies such as decentralized trials, electronic data capture, and
AI-driven monitoring.
